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,660 in Mexico City versus $3,494 in Schwyz.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,565 in Mexico City versus $5,630 in Schwyz.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,470 in Mexico City versus $7,765 in Schwyz.

Living in Mexico City costs roughly 53% less than in Schwyz,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ities are pricier than the global median: Mexico City 21% above, Schwyz 155% above.
